			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>If you see Alec Baldwin in public, it&#8217;s probably a good idea to advise your party to slowly back away while leaving any food you have with you on the ground. No sudden movements. That&#8217;s a lesson that <a href="http://www.nypost.com/p/news/local/alec_fast_slur_ious_tzxXtwrX49oGHN1VaG08hM" target="_blank" rel="nofollow">NY Post</a> reporters and photographers just can&#8217;t seem to learn for whatever reason.</p>
<p>Baldwin allegedly grabbed a female reporter by the arm and wished death upon her before making racist comments to her photographer.</p>
<blockquote><p>Baldwin was asked for comment on a lawsuit against his wife, Hilaria, involving her work as a yoga instructor.<br />
(He) grabbed the reporter, Tara Palmeri, by her arm and told her, “I want you to <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/movies/films/choke' class='linkify' target='_blank'>choke</a> to death,” Palmeri told police, for whom she played an audiotape of the conversation.<br />
He then called G.N. Miller — a decorated retired detective with the NYPD’s Organized Crime Control Bureau and a staff photographer for The Post — a “coon, a drug dealer.’’<br />
At one point, Miller showed Baldwin ID to prove he’s a retired NYPD cop, which Baldwin dismissed as “fake.”<br />
Cops were called, and Miller, 56, and Baldwin, 54, both filed harassment claims against each other.</p></blockquote>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/lorne-michaels-939/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Lorne Michaels</a> was on the Television Critics Association panel for the new NBC comedy <em>Up All Night</em>. After the panel when the press gaggled around him, he spoke about his thoughts and hopes for <em><a href="http://www.screenjunkies.com/tv/tv-news/every-30-rock-liz-lemon-flashback/" target="_blank">30 Rock</a></em>. With contracts coming up at the end of season six, and stars like <a href="http://www.screenjunkies.com/movies/movie-news/see-alec-baldwin-and-russell-brand-in-first-rock-of-ages-photo/" target="_blank">Alec Baldwin</a> threatening <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/retirement-733/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>retirement</a>, Michaels still sees <em>30 </em>rockin’ along.</p>
<p>“Listen, you can’t imagine doing the show without Alec but I couldn’t imagine doing the show without Chevy either and we’re still on the air,” Michaels said, invoking Chase’s departure from <em>SNL.</em> “I would hope that we would never have to go on without him but we’re going to keep doing the show.”</p>
<p><a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/tina-fey-154/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Tina Fey</a> is at home this <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/summer/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>summer</a> expecting a baby. Then she’s ready to go back to work too. “Right now she’s having a baby but I know that she’s completely committed to the show, as are a lot of people who work there. Alec is a huge part of it. It’s a great group. I think it still has a lot of vitality and life in it. We’re all pretty much determined to keep it going, and I’m hopeful.”</p>
<p>Michaels also spoke out about <em>30 Rock</em> star Tracy Morgan’s controversial anti-gay rant and how it might affect his return to the show. “We haven’t started yet but obviously everyone has been talking. I think he totally regretted it, he apologized for it. I think it was a thoughtless thing to say but it was the middle of a concert and he was trying to be provocative I think. It just blew up and I think he confronted it and dealt with it. I know what kind of man he is and he’s not a hateful person in any way, shape or form. What he said was stupid and there’s no justification for it, I’m just saying I don’t think it came from any real thought really.”</p>
<p>The subsequent <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/tracy-morgan-365/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Tracy Morgan</a> controversy, about a routine on the mentally challenged, made less waves. “I think that’s from his act from 15 years ago. It was in his HBO special. When you scrutinize anybody’s comedy, it’s not the criteria you should really judge it by. He’s not being taught in schools.”</p>

<p>When I first heard the news that <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/will-ferrell-199/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Will Ferrell</a> and <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/mark-wahlberg-420/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Mark Wahlberg</a> were reuniting from <em>The Other Guys </em>to play opposing amateur football coaches in <a href="http://www.screenjunkies.com/movies/movie-news/the-other-guys-to-re-team-for-turkey-bowl/" target="_blank"><em>Turkey Bowl</em></a>, I was mildly excited. Now my mild excitement continues, with the news that Wahlberg&#8217;s <em>The Departed </em>compatriot <a href="http://www.screenjunkies.com/movies/movie-news/alec-baldwin-wises-up-and-drops-out-of-rock-of-ages/" target="_blank">Alec Baldwin</a> has signed on to play Wahlberg&#8217;s father.</p>
<p>This goes along with the idea that maybe-director (he&#8217;s not attached of yet, but he&#8217;s &#8220;reserve[d] that right&#8221;) <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/adam-mckay-351/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Adam McKay</a> wants <em>Turkey Bowl </em>stuffed with celebrity cameos. He also is reportedly trying to get <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/jeremy-renner-423/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Jeremy Renner</a> and <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/rob-riggle/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Rob Riggle</a>, with presumably many others as well. Here&#8217;s an incredibly long and in-depth plot synopsis, straight from McKay&#8217;s mouth:</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;&#8221;It’s about these two rival families from — we’re thinking <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/philadelphia/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Philadelphia</a>  but we need to check in with Wahlberg and Ferrell and see what kind of  accents they want to do. <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/alec-baldwin-934/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Alec Baldwin</a> is the patriarch of one of the  families, and Wahlberg is his son. He saw the Kennedys playing football  on their front lawn at <a href='http://www.screenjunkies.com/tag/thanksgiving-75/' class='linkify' target='_blank'>Thanksgiving</a>, and boom, that’s it: “Anything the  Kennedys do, we’re doing.” His family starts playing the other family  that lives across the park from them. Over the years, Baldwin’s family  hasn’t done too well — they own a crappy little bar in town — while the  other family, which Will’s character eventually becomes the patriarch  of, becomes really successful. The game gets nastier and nastier as the  years go on, and Ferrell’s family starts just destroying the other  family. After a massive heart attack, Baldwin’s character’s dying wish  is that his estranged son, Mark, take over the game and finally win one.  So Wahlberg has to put this ramshackle, convict, gambling-addict family  back together again and beat the richies. The whole spirit of it is  that it’s just a giant, fun ensemble comedy. We want to populate it with  people we love. There’s a funny subplot with Rob Riggle where he’s a  gay cousin that Wahlberg’s family sort of turned their backs on but he  played football at Fresno State and they need him. We’re going to try to  get Jeremy Renner to play an ex-con. The idea is to bring in, like, 15  people that we love in and just do a big, funny holiday movie.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
